Summer 2002 – Journey to the Flame
Centuries ago in long forgotten times when the Earth was cold and dark.
All animals could openly communicate but none had known the gift of fire.
The only light found at night was the small gifts of sight given to us by Grandmother moon on the days she was full.
And The days of the new moon meant utter darkness, save for the tiny shimmer of the stars when they peeked out from behind the clouds.
No food had ever been cooked.
No tool had ever been forged,
and on the long dark nights of winter huddling together in the blackness was the only source of warmth.
This is what it meant to live without fire!
However, there was an island where there lived a race of giant creatures, their name long forgotten, who had been blessed by the striking of lightning.
Gifted FIRE by the great spirit.
Lights at night had been seen on this island and the wind whispered stories of this thing named "FIRE".
The birds confirmed it, a glowing crimson slash in th night like nothing they had ever seen,
sparkling in the center of a grove on the island.
All the animals had gathered together in council to discuss this "FIRE"
In the summer of 2002 Mythmaker Productions preformed its first full length fire preformance peice.
Although Quite versed in sacerd improve theatre and having years experience in fire prformance and ritual theatre,
this was the first "branching out" into larger, more focused, scripted preformances.
With a cast of 22 and a focus on the empowerment of new parents (10 kids,12 parents, 8 of wich being couples)
With practices sometimes being more like a circus, It was quite the test indeed and succeded magically!
Costume design, mask making, fire choreography and chant workshoping was all done from within the group.
